Thresholding based on percentage#

def plot_amplitude_masking(ds, shot_id=None, nperseg=2000, nfft=2000,
                           sigma=1.0, apply_gaussian=True, apply_mask=True,
                           mask_percentile=60, use_percentage=True,
                           tmin=0.1, tmax=0.46, fmax_kHz=50, cmap='jet'):
    """
    Plots the STFT spectrogram with optional Gaussian blur and masking. This is one function doing everything. No helper needed.

    Parameters:
    - ds: xarray.DataArray with 'time_mirnov'
    - shot_id: Optional shot ID
    - apply_gaussian: Whether to apply Gaussian blur
    - apply_mask: Whether to apply masking
    - mask_percentile: If use_percentage=True, keep top X% of points.
                       Else, mask values below the Xth percentile.
    - use_percentage: Use percentage thresholding instead of percentile
    """

    # Compute STFT
    sample_rate = 1 / float(ds.time_mirnov[1] - ds.time_mirnov[0])
    f, t, Zxx = stft(ds.values, fs=int(sample_rate), nperseg=nperseg, nfft=nfft)
    magnitude = np.abs(Zxx)  # Take magnitude of complex STFT

    # Optional Gaussian blur (for smoothing the spectrogram)
    if apply_gaussian:
        magnitude = gaussian_filter(magnitude, sigma=sigma)

    # Clip negative values just in case blur introduced due to skewed data like sharp gradients
    magnitude = np.clip(magnitude, 0, None)

    # Apply masking
    if apply_mask:
        if use_percentage:
            # Flatten and sort finite values to find cutoff for top X% values
            valid = magnitude[np.isfinite(magnitude)].flatten()
            if valid.size > 0:
                sorted_vals = np.sort(valid)
                cut_index = int((1 - mask_percentile / 100) * len(sorted_vals))
                cutoff_value = sorted_vals[cut_index]
                # Mask all values below cutoff
                magnitude = np.where(magnitude >= cutoff_value, magnitude, np.nan)
        else:
            # Use standard percentile-based thresholding
            threshold = np.percentile(magnitude, mask_percentile)
            magnitude = np.where(magnitude >= threshold, magnitude, np.nan)

    # save a copy of the segmented spectrogram
    segmented_stft = magnitude.copy()


    # Skip if everything got masked (to avoid plotting empty images)
    if not np.any(np.isfinite(magnitude)):
        print(f"Shot {shot_id} — all values masked. Skipping plot.")
        return

    # Plot the spectrogram
    fig, ax = plt.subplots(figsize=(15, 5))
    cax = ax.pcolormesh(
        t, f / 1000, magnitude,
        shading='nearest',
        cmap=plt.get_cmap(cmap, 15),
        norm=LogNorm(vmin=1e-5)
    )
    ax.set_ylim(0, fmax_kHz)
    ax.set_xlim(tmin, tmax)
    ax.set_ylabel('Frequency [kHz]')
    ax.set_xlabel('Time [sec]')
    title = f"Filtered STFT - Shot {shot_id}" if shot_id else "Filtered STFT"
    ax.set_title(title)
    plt.colorbar(cax, ax=ax, label='Amplitude')
    plt.tight_layout()

    return t, f, segmented_stft, Zxx

Extract information about each contour#

def extract_contour_features(contour, t, f, Zxx):
    """Extract features from a single contour."""
    time_idx = np.clip(contour[:, 1].astype(int), 0, len(t) - 1)
    freq_idx = np.clip(contour[:, 0].astype(int), 0, len(f) - 1)
    
    times = t[time_idx]
    freqs = f[freq_idx]# / 1000  # in kHz
    amps = np.abs(Zxx[freq_idx, time_idx])
    
    # Handle degenerate contours
    if len(times) < 2:
        return None
    
    # Features
    duration = times.max() - times.min()
    freq_span = freqs.max() - freqs.min()
    slope = np.polyfit(times, freqs, 1)[0]
    avg_amp = np.mean(amps)
    max_amp = np.max(amps)
    
    return {
        'duration': duration,
        'freq_span': freq_span,
        'slope': slope,
        'avg_amp': avg_amp,
        'max_amp': max_amp,
        'start_time': times.min(),
        'end_time': times.max(),
        'start_freq': freqs[0],
        'end_freq': freqs[-1],
        'length': len(times),
    }
